    Abstract: The present invention refers to a method for twisting and covering interchanged spinning. It utilizes a programmed way to control the ring spinning frame in producing twisted and covered structures thus spinning composite yarns. The method feeds filament or staple yarn into different selected positions in the spinning triangle upon the tension interchange to rapidly spin two different structured yarns, therefore, enriches variety of the woven fabric and increase the industrial value.

    Abstract: This is a fancy yarn spinning device with the number of counts and twisting varying according to the variation of waveforms, designed with pre-defined waveforms, working with fixed cycles, fixed amplitudes, or random cycles, and random amplitudes, which serve as drafting and twisting parameters for the ring spinning machine. This device involves a servomotor and a inverter, for respective control of the revolutions of front, middle, and rear rollers of the ring spinning machine and the spindle, so the drafting rate and twisting of all areas of the ring spinning machine can change continuously with pre-defined settings, to produce yarns with variable number of counts and twisted conditions. The design of variable waveforms can also achieve different touch and visual feelings.

    Abstract: The present invention relates to a sanding apparatus used for the production of air textured yarn and false twist yarn. The apparatus comprises a motor, a housing provided with a guide groove, and a frictional disk connected to the motor and enclosed in the housing. The apparatus can be arranged in an intermediate section of the production process to generate short hair on the outer surface of yarn by the contact between the frictional disk and moving yarn. Accordingly the products made by the apparatus have soft tactile feelings when touched.

    Abstract: The present invention relates to conducting yarn. The conducting yarn of the invention mainly consists of a strand of nonconductive yarn crossedly wrapped with two stainless steel threads. The yarn made in this way has better softness, high impact strength, and good conducting properties, and is especially adaptable for use in fencing jackets.

    Abstract: The invention disclosed a two-head one-cubican drawing system provided with two sets of drafting mechanisms and two coilers. A cubic can is used to receive slivers from two coilers so as to decrease the space occupied by the system and facilitate the arrangement of automatic transportation. Through the control of driving mechanisms by transverse devices, evener drawing frames, and rollers the system can have two slivers equally formed in the cubic can.

    Abstract: A device is provided for applying a source of high-voltage static electricity in combination with suction to remove trash and dust from raw cotton in a preparation process before carding. The device includes a pair of plastic plates disposed on opposing ends of a housing. A pair of copper plates extend between the plastic plates and have a plurality of holes formed therethrough. The sources of static electricity are connected to the pair of copper plates and the raw cotton fibers are passed therebetween. A suction of 30-100 Pa is applied within the housing for removal of the trash and dust.
